Abstract:
Against complex simulation system’s features such as broad knowledge, large scale and wide technical field, a method for complex simulation credibility evaluation based on group analytic hierarchy process (AHP) is proposed. First, an approach to deriving expert synthesis weight is presented, which integrates the expert subjective weight and evaluation result of expert’s ability from the judgement matrix. Then, judgement matrices constructed by different experts are aggregated by using Hadamard convex combination, and a property of the Hadamard convex combination of the judgement matrix is proved, furthermore, group assessment value of complex simulation credibility is obtained. Finally an example is given to validate the effectiveness of the proposed method.
